Inventory Control

The TIMS Inventory module provides the tools needed to track receivings, usages, adjustments and transfers related to specific warehouses and depots or stock in general.  Stock takes can be custom designed to allow the user to focus on a particular range of item codes, bin locations or random selection of items.

Easy data entry screen for entering receivings, adjustments, transfers and usages.

Warranty tracking is available in terms of months, kilometres and/or engine hours. This is closely related to and integrated with the TIMS Purchase Order and Fleet Maintenance modules.

Expected Life of an item can be entered in terms of months, kilometres and/or engine hours. This enables the manager to identify parts not lasting an expected period and to take pro-active maintenance.

Serialised Item tracking of major parts can be used. E.g. Tyre recaps and position on the vehicle can be tracked by serial number.

Stock items can be grouped into 3 $-Value categories to determine the frequency those items are included in a generated cyclic stock take.

Rebuild Items can be assigned to an Item which automatically raises a service requirement in TIMS Fleet Maintenance when the associated Item is replaced on a vehicle.

Each Item File is linked to service and repair history showing which vehicles have been fitted with this part.

Consumable groups can be setup as Items which enables the weighted amortization of consumable costs across the whole fleet for a specified period.
